Think about it: What are the recurring themes in your life? Are there patterns in your relationships, your career choices, or your reactions to stress? Identifying these patterns offers valuable insight into your strengths, weaknesses, and underlying motivations. Maybe you consistently choose projects that challenge you creatively, revealing a deep-seated need for self-expression. Perhaps you notice a tendency to avoid conflict, indicating a need to develop stronger assertiveness skills. These observations are not judgments, but rather building blocks in the construction of a more complete understanding of yourself. By acknowledging both your strengths and your weaknesses, you can build a more realistic and compassionate self-image, fostering self-acceptance and personal growth. This process allows you to actively shape your life rather than passively reacting to it.
